Description

Source data for:

Recycling of Bacterial RNA Polymerase by the Swi2/Snf2 ATPase RapA

In press, PNAS 2023

Koe Inlowa, Debora Tenenbaumb, Larry J. Friedmana, Jane Kondevb,*, and Jeff Gellesa,*

aDepartment of Biochemistry and bDepartment of Physics, Brandeis University, Waltham, MA 02453, USA.
*To whom correspondence may be addressed. Email: gelles@brandeis.edu (J.G.) or kondev@brandeis.edu (J.K.).

Source data for the single-molecule experiments is provided as “intervals” files that can be read and manipulated by the Matlab program “Imscroll”, which is publicly available at:

https://github.com/gelles-brandeis/CoSMoS_Analysis

The files are identified in Source data index.docx, the contents of which are also reproduced below.
